From a tax planning standpoint, we think laddering capital gains tax deferment throughout the year by taking advantage of the QOF regulation’s rolling 180-day look-back period, can be very advantageous come the year-end. Most forms of capital gains qualify for tax deferment—stocks, bonds, mutual funds, ETFs, real estate, the sale of a business, trademarks, patents, cryptocurrencies, precious metals, collectibles, livestock, cars, aircraft, marine craft, etc. In the meantime, the potential growth and income from capital gains reinvested into a QOF have an opportunity to be compounded free of taxation as long as the QOF investment is held for at least 10 years through December 31, 2047.

Another key point: there is no limit on how much in realized capital gains one can reinvest into a QOF. QOFs, like Belpointe OZ, offer investors looking to shelter capital gains a viable opportunity. As part of the program structure, most taxable gains invested in a QOF are not recognized (on the federal level and in many states) until December 31, 2026 (due with the filing of the 2026 return in 2027), or until an investor’s interest in the QOF is sold or exchanged, whichever occurs first. The potential to compound growth and income thereafter within QOFs on a tax-free basis expires December 31, 2047.

A Viable Alternative to 1031 Tax-Free Exchanges

We’ve seen a pickup in interest from property owners about how Belpointe OZ might represent an attractive alternative to Internal Revenue Code Section 1031 like-kind exchanges. Investors that have sold real estate within the past 180 days and that may be under pressure to comply with Section 1031 regulations in order to complete a tax-free exchange, may want to avoid the inconvenience of having to identify a replacement property (and one or more alternative replacement properties, just in case a replacement property falls through) within 45 days of selling the original property, escrowing the sale proceeds with a 1031 qualified intermediary, and closing on a replacement property within 180 days of the sale of the original property. Instead, investors may want to consider investing capital gains from the sale of the original property into a QOF, like Belpointe OZ.
